PM Invites Skanska for ‘last-ditch talks’

Malta Independent Friday, 15 October 2004, 00:00 Last update: about 15 years ago

Dr Lawrence Gonzi has invited the chairman for a meeting, to be held preferably next week.

A spokesman for the Prime Minister said that the letter acknowledges the fact that the negotiations have broken down, but shows the government’s intention to reach a conclusion that is convenient for both.

The government is insisting on two issues, which are linked to each other. The first is on the costing of the hospital and the second is on the establishment of a date as to when Skanska will complete the project.

The government wants to establish penalties if this deadline is not met, the spokesman said.
